The “Wireless Communications and Networks” department of the Fraunhofer Institute for Telecommunications, Heinrich Hertz Institute, develops wireless communication systems with a focus on future mobile communications generations (5G+ and 6G). The “Smart Wireless Connectivity (SWC)” working group works in an international environment on research projects to design communication methods and signal processing algorithms for future wireless technologies.
